科学领域:

  • 神经学 神经学
  • 认知科学 认知科学
  • 老年学是一门学科.

背景情况:

  • 嗅觉识别缺陷是阿尔茨海默病 (AD) 和轻度认知障碍 (MCI) 的早期指标.
  • 以前的研究将嗅觉识别与认知健康的老年人间的情节性记忆联系起来.
  • 嗅觉识别可以作为一个标记器,用于发作性记忆的下降,在个体有风险的AD.

研究的目的:

  • 评估嗅觉识别对MCI和主观认知衰退 (SCD) 患者的情节性记忆的预测价值.
  • 探索嗅觉识别在区分MCI和SCD组的有用性.

主要方法:

  • 宾夕法尼亚大学的气味识别测试 (UPSIT) 对93名参与者 (48名SCD,45名MCI) 的嗅觉功能进行了评估.
  • 用Rey听觉语言学习测试 (RAVLT) 的回忆分数测量了情节性记忆.
  • 拉索回归和线性差异分析 (LDA) 用于预测建模和组分类.

主要成果:

  • UPSIT分数与即时和延迟RAVLT召回有显著的相关性.
  • 将UPSIT分数纳入预测模型改善了插曲性记忆的解释方差.
  • 在MCI组的UPSIT分数明显低于SCD组,LDA在群体歧视方面达到中度准确性 (69%).

结论:

  • 嗅觉识别可以提高SCD或MCI患者的情节性记忆预测.
  • 气味识别测试显示出潜在的选工具,用于与AD相关的认知衰退.
  • 需要进一步的研究来了解阿尔茨海默氏症嗅觉障碍的机制,因为它并不特定于该疾病.
